The Grandview Agricultural Community Centre has good reason to celebrate. Shovels will be in the ground for the new ice plant this year, after many months and many fundraising events. 

Alia Marcinkow, Grandview & District Recreation Commission Chair, said their upcoming End to End Gala is a great way to show their appreciation for everyone who's helped, and give the project another small kick of funding. 

"We will be having a really nice dinner catered by one of our local ladies, from there we're also going to have some silent auction prizes, and a rainbow auction, and also a live auction for a couple of very special items we have received...it's just going to be a night of merryment to celebrate hopefully the end of our fundraising, that's why we called it End to End, cause you skate from end to end on a hockey rink and you throw Rocks end to end, and we kind of feel like this is the end to end of our fundraising efforts, since our ice plant is going in this September," said Marcinkow. 

The auctions are a big part of this event's way to raise funds, and Marcinkow said the live auction should be exciting, especially with the quality of those special items they received. 

"There's going to be a few jerseys, and one of them is a very up and coming NHL-er, who's been said that he is in the leagues with Sidney Crosby, Connor McDavid, he's kind of the next big thing, so that's pretty exciting," said Marcinkow. 

They're well on their way to selling out the event. Tickets are $60, and going fast. Marcinkow said she hopes to see a sold out crowd, even if it means it gets packed. 

"We are hoping to sell out at 300, which would be quite stuffed in there, but we are over halfway there which is wonderful," said Marcinkow. 

The End to End Gala takes place at the GKCC, in the same parking lot as the GACC, and will be held on April 18th starting at 5:00 PM. The purchase deadline is April 15th.
